Understanding Booster Seat Weight Limits

Booster seats play a crucial role in child passenger safety by positioning the seat belt correctly across a child’s body. But knowing exactly what is the weight limit for a booster seat? is essential to ensure your child is both safe and comfortable during car rides. Weight limits are not arbitrary—they’re carefully set by manufacturers based on rigorous safety testing and regulatory standards.

Typically, booster seats are designed for children who have outgrown their forward-facing car seats but are still too small to use adult seat belts safely. This transition generally happens when kids weigh between 40 and 120 pounds. However, these numbers can vary widely depending on the booster seat’s design—whether it’s a high-back booster or a backless model—and the specific brand.

Manufacturers provide detailed guidelines in their manuals, specifying minimum and maximum weight limits. These limits ensure that the booster seat can properly position the vehicle’s lap and shoulder belts to reduce injury risk during crashes. Exceeding these limits compromises safety because the seat belt may not fit correctly, which can lead to serious injuries.

Why Weight Limits Matter More Than Age

Age is often used as a rough guideline for when to switch to a booster seat, but weight is actually more important. Kids grow at different rates, so two children of the same age might require very different types of restraint systems.

A child who weighs less than the minimum limit might not be adequately supported by the booster seat, while one who exceeds the maximum limit might be too big for it. In both cases, incorrect usage increases injury risk during accidents.

Weight limits work hand-in-hand with height recommendations because proper belt positioning depends on both factors. For example, if a child is too short, even if they meet the weight requirement, they may need a high-back booster for better head and neck support.

Types of Booster Seats and Their Weight Limits

Booster seats come in various styles, each with distinct weight capacities tailored to different stages of child growth:

    • High-Back Booster Seats: These usually accommodate children from 30 or 40 pounds up to around 100-120 pounds.
    • Backless Booster Seats: Typically designed for kids weighing between 40 and 100 pounds.
    • Combination Seats: These transition from forward-facing harness seats to boosters and often support weights from as low as 20 pounds up to about 100-120 pounds.

The choice between these depends not only on weight but also on your vehicle’s seating configuration and your child’s comfort needs.

High-Back vs. Backless Boosters: Weight Limit Differences

High-back boosters provide head and neck support, making them ideal for vehicles without headrests or with low seat backs. They usually have slightly lower minimum weight limits (around 30-40 pounds) because they’re designed to accommodate younger or smaller children transitioning out of harnessed car seats.

Backless boosters rely more heavily on your vehicle’s seat back for support and generally start at higher minimum weights (around 40 pounds). They tend to have similar maximum weight limits but are less suitable for younger children who need additional upper body protection.

The Science Behind Booster Seat Weight Limits

Weight limits aren’t just numbers slapped on labels; they’re grounded in physics and crash test data. The goal is to ensure that during sudden stops or collisions:

    • The lap belt lies flat across the upper thighs—not the stomach.
    • The shoulder belt crosses the middle of the chest—not the neck or face.
    • The child remains securely restrained without excessive movement.

Booster seats raise children up so adult seat belts fit properly. If a child is below the minimum weight threshold, their body may not be positioned correctly within the booster shell, reducing restraint effectiveness.

At higher weights beyond maximum limits, materials like plastic shells or foam padding may no longer provide adequate protection or structural integrity under crash forces. This can cause belt slippage or improper restraint placement.

Crash test dummies representing various sizes simulate impacts at different speeds while wearing booster seats during certification tests. These tests help determine safe operational ranges—directly influencing published weight limits.

Regulatory Standards Influencing Weight Limits

In many countries, government agencies regulate car seats through strict safety standards:

    • United States: Federal Motor Vehicle Safety Standard (FMVSS) No. 213 sets performance requirements including strength tests that influence allowable weight ranges.
    • Europe: ECE R44/04 regulation defines group classifications based on weight (e.g., Group 2/3 boosters cover roughly 15-36 kg).
    • Canada: Transport Canada enforces similar standards aligned with FMVSS but may have slight variations in testing protocols.

Manufacturers must design products that meet these regulations while balancing comfort and usability features—resulting in varied but consistent weight limit ranges across brands.

How To Choose The Right Booster Seat Based On Weight

Choosing a booster seat isn’t just about picking one off the shelf; it involves matching your child’s current size with product specifications carefully:

    • Check Your Child’s Weight: Use an accurate scale regularly since kids grow fast.
    • Review Manufacturer Guidelines: Read labels and manuals closely for both minimum and maximum weights.
    • Select Based on Vehicle Compatibility: Some boosters work better in certain cars due to size or installation method.
    • Aim For Adjustable Features: Seats with adjustable headrests or multiple belt guides accommodate growth better.

If your child is close to exceeding one model’s upper limit but still under another’s, opt for the one with greater capacity without sacrificing fit quality.

The Role of Height Alongside Weight

Weight alone doesn’t tell the whole story—height matters too because proper belt fit depends heavily on where belts cross your child’s torso:

    • Lap belts should sit low across hips/thighs.
    • Shoulder belts must rest snugly over collarbones without touching neck or face.

Some manufacturers specify height ranges alongside weights—for example: “Suitable for children weighing 40-100 lbs and between 38-57 inches tall.” This dual criterion ensures optimal safety alignment during travel.

The Impact of Ignoring Booster Seat Weight Limits

Ignoring what is the weight limit for a booster seat? can lead to dangerous consequences:

If a child uses a booster beyond its recommended maximum weight:

    • The plastic shell could crack or deform under pressure during an accident.
    • Belt positioning might shift dangerously toward soft tissue areas like abdomen instead of pelvis.
    • The restraint system might fail entirely due to excessive strain on anchor points or buckles.

If used below minimum weight thresholds:

    • The child may slide around inside the seat causing poor restraint performance.
    • Lack of proper headrest support could increase risk of whiplash injuries in collisions.
    • Belt fit becomes inconsistent leading to discomfort or unsafe positioning over time.

An Overview Table: Typical Booster Seat Weight Limits by Type

Booster Seat Type Minimum Weight Limit (lbs) Maximum Weight Limit (lbs)
High-Back Booster Seat 30 – 40 100 – 120
Backless Booster Seat 40 – 45 100 – 110
Combination Seat (Harness + Booster) 20 – 30 (Harness mode) 100 – 120 (Booster mode)

This table summarizes general ranges; always consult specific product details before purchase.

The Transition From Car Seats To Boosters: What To Watch For?

Kids graduate from forward-facing car seats with harnesses once they exceed those devices’ height or weight limits—often around 40 pounds—and then move into boosters that rely on vehicle belts instead of internal harnesses.

Parents sometimes wonder if it’s okay to move kids into boosters early just because they look big enough—but fitting within recommended weight boundaries matters most here. Early transition risks improper restraint fitting that could cause harm rather than protect.

Signs your child is ready include:

    • Sitting comfortably with back against vehicle seat without slouching.
    • Knees bending naturally at edge of vehicle seat cushion.
    • Lap belt resting low over hips rather than stomach area.

If any of these don’t check out yet—even if your kid weighs enough—consider waiting longer before switching out car seats entirely.

Troubleshooting Common Issues With Booster Seat Fitment Related To Weight Limits

Sometimes parents report discomfort complaints from kids using boosters near upper weight thresholds—tight straps or pinching points might appear as padding compresses under heavier loads.

Solutions include:

    • Selecting models engineered with reinforced frames designed for heavier kids up to higher max weights;
    • Avoiding backless boosters if additional head support becomes necessary;
    • Migrating toward combination seats offering extended harness use before full booster mode;

This approach maximizes safety without sacrificing comfort as children grow through critical stages.
